在这个数字化时代,网站已经成为企业和个人展示形象、传播信息的重要平台。而网站的性能与用户体验直接影响到访问者的满意度。为了帮助大家更好地掌握Web前端新技术,提升网站性能和用户体验,本文将介绍一些实用的技巧。

一、优化网站加载速度

1. 压缩图片

图片是影响网站加载速度的重要因素。可以使用在线工具或编程语言(如Python)对图片进行压缩,减小图片文件大小。以下是一个使用Python压缩图片的示例代码:

from PIL import Image
import os

def compress_images(directory, output_directory, quality=75):
    for filename in os.listdir(directory):
        if filename.lower().endswith(('.png', '.jpg', '.jpeg')):
            img_path = os.path.join(directory, filename)
            img = Image.open(img_path)
            img.save(os.path.join(output_directory, filename), 'JPEG', quality=quality)

# 压缩图片
compress_images('path/to原图文件夹', 'path/to压缩后图片文件夹')

2. 异步加载资源

将CSS、JavaScript等资源异步加载,可以减少主线程的负担,提高页面加载速度。以下是一个异步加载JavaScript的示例代码:

<script async src="path/to/your-script.js"></script>

二、提升用户体验

1. 优化响应式设计

响应式设计可以使网站在不同设备上都能良好展示。可以使用CSS框架(如Bootstrap)或编写自定义代码实现响应式布局。

2. 提供清晰的导航

清晰的导航可以帮助用户快速找到所需信息。合理规划网站结构,使用面包屑导航、搜索框等工具,提升用户体验。

3. 优化页面布局

合理的页面布局可以使内容更易读,提升用户体验。以下是一些建议:

  • 使用合适的字体、字号和颜色。
  • 保持页面元素对齐。
  • 合理使用间距。
  • 避免使用过多的动画和特效。

三、总结

掌握Web前端新技术,优化网站性能和用户体验,是提高网站竞争力的关键。通过以上技巧,相信您已经对如何提升网站性能和用户体验有了更深入的了解。希望这些实用技巧能够帮助您打造更优秀的网站。